Gaussian Processes Regression with Joint Learning of Precision Matrix

In the traditional Gaussian process regression (GPR), covariance matrix is modeled by a kernel function, which is dominated by a set of hyper-parameters. However, the estimation of such hyper-parameters are generally a highly nonconvex optimization problem, which imposes computational difficulties and undermines the practical performance. To improve the prediction accuracy, we propose in this paper a novel GPR algorithm that introduces the estimate of precision matrix of target values. Covariance and precision matrices are coupled by a regularized approximation error term. In practice, the precision matrix and hyper-parameters are trained by the alternating optimization. Experimental results demonstrate that the performance of the joint-learning formulation is superior to traditional GPR.

[1]  Takao Kobayashi,et al.  Duration prediction using multiple Gaussian process experts for GPR-based speech synthesis , 2017, 2017 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[2]  C. D. Keeling,et al.  Atmospheric CO 2 records from sites in the SIO air sampling network , 1994 .

[3]  Xinbo Gao,et al.  Single-Image Super-Resolution Using Active-Sampling Gaussian Process Regression , 2016, IEEE Transactions on Image Processing.

[4]  Carl E. Rasmussen,et al.  A Unifying View of Sparse Approximate Gaussian Process Regression , 2005, J. Mach. Learn. Res..

[5]  Andrew Gordon Wilson,et al.  Kernel Interpolation for Scalable Structured Gaussian Processes (KISS-GP) , 2015, ICML.

[6]  B. Silverman,et al.  Some Aspects of the Spline Smoothing Approach to Non‐Parametric Regression Curve Fitting , 1985 .

[7]  Jonathan P. How,et al.  Bayesian Nonparametric Adaptive Control Using Gaussian Processes , 2015, IEEE Transactions on Neural Networks and Learning Systems.

[8]  Harrison H. Zhou,et al.  Estimating Sparse Precision Matrix: Optimal Rates of Convergence and Adaptive Estimation , 2012, 1212.2882.

[9]  Stefan Schaal,et al.  Incremental Online Learning in High Dimensions , 2005, Neural Computation.

[10]  Andrew Gordon Wilson,et al.  Gaussian Process Covariance Kernels for Pattern Discovery and Extrapolation , 2013, ArXiv.

[11]  Zoubin Ghahramani,et al.  Sparse Gaussian Processes using Pseudo-inputs , 2005, NIPS.

[12]  Fakhrul Alam,et al.  Gaussian Process Model Predictive Control of Unknown Nonlinear Systems , 2016, ArXiv.

[13]  D. Rubinfeld,et al.  Hedonic housing prices and the demand for clean air , 1978 .